Technical Writer Salary in Kansas City, Missouri

The median technical writer salary in Kansas City, MO is $73,563 per year, which is 8% below the national median and 4.5% above the Missouri state average.

Technical Writer Salary in Kansas City by Experience

In Kansas City, an entry-level technical writer earns around $47,840, while experienced professionals earn up to $108,560 per year. The local cost of living index is 92% of the national average.

Salary Percentiles in Kansas City, MO

Percentile Kansas City
10th Percentile $45,816
25th Percentile $57,960
Median (50th) $73,563
75th Percentile $94,576
90th Percentile $118,312

Job Outlook

Nationally, technical writer employment is projected to grow 7% over the next decade (faster than average). Demand in Kansas City may vary based on local industry and population growth.
